Are you waiting right now? Waiting on an answer? Waiting on peace? Waiting on hope? I think we all have times in our lives when we must wait on God. Those times can feel arduously painful, can’t they? It feels as though the waiting will never end, doesn’t it? So what are we to do?
Today’s verse gives us great insight…if you are in a time of waiting, serve.
“Behold, as the eyes of servants look to the hand of their master,
as the eyes of a maidservant to the hand of her mistress,
so our eyes look to the Lord our God, till he has mercy upon us.”
(Psalms 123:2, ESV)
Robin Chance shared a great quote with me a couple weeks ago. It said, “If you’re waiting on God, do what waiters do: serve.” That’s great advice, from Scripture to the quote, because it reminds us to keep our eyes fixed on Creator and not our circumstances.
